Mutual Funds in Spain (Rentabilidad de los Fondos de Inversion en 1991-2006)
Pablo Fernandez University of Navarra - IESE Business School Jose Maria Carabias London Business School; University of Navarra - IESE Business School Lucia De Miguel University of Navarra - IESE Business School May 24, 2007 Abstract: During the last 10 years (1997-2006), the average return of the mutual funds in Spain (2.7%) was smaller than the average inflation (2.9%). Nevertheless, on December 31, 2006, 8,819,809 investors in the 2,779 existing mutual funds had 254 billion euros. 246 new mutual funds were launched during 2006. Only 23 of the 649 mutual funds with 10-year history outperformed the benchmark.
